Mortgage lenders in Artesia, California help home buyers and homeowners secure loans for purchasing or refinancing property. These professionals guide clients through California-specific requirements, such as the state's non-judicial foreclosure process and disclosure laws. Working with a local lender can simplify the loan process for properties in Artesia and surrounding areas.

What Does a Mortgage Lender in Artesia Cost?

Typical costs for a mortgage lender in California include an origination fee of 0.5% to 1% of the loan amount, plus appraisal fees of $500 to $700 and title insurance of $1,000 to $3,000. Closing costs generally range from 2% to 5% of the purchase price. Costs vary by loan type, property value, and lender. This is general information, not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What documents do I need for a mortgage loan in Artesia?
You typically need proof of income, tax returns, bank statements, and identification. California lenders also require a property appraisal and title report to verify the home's value and ownership.
How long does it take to close a mortgage in California?
The average mortgage closing in California takes 30 to 45 days. This timeline includes processing, underwriting, and meeting state disclosure requirements under California law.
